The Rise of Digitalization in Insurance

The rise of digitalization in insurance has opened up a world of possibilities for consumers. By leveraging new technologies, providers can offer customers more comprehensive coverage packages and enhanced customer experiences. Customers can now access insurance information from any device at any time. It allows them to acquire quotes, review policy provisions, make payments, and file claims quickly and conveniently.

Due to digitalization, there has been an increase in innovation within the industry. Insurers need to leverage artificial intelligence (AI) companies and machine learning algorithms to create predictive models that enable them to accurately assess risk levels and develop customized policies for individual customers. These advanced technologies also allow insurers to provide real-time guidance on risk management strategies for businesses and personal insurance clients.

In addition, digital platforms have allowed insurers to expand their reach globally. They can offer products and services in multiple countries without an established presence through online tools such as automated underwriting systems, telematics devices, and mobile apps. It not only helps them gain access to new markets but also allows them to better serve existing customers with greater accuracy and efficiency.

Digital tools have also allowed insurers to provide a more personalized experience for their customers by collecting data from various sources—including web browsing history—to create custom profiles that help identify needs better than ever before. With this data, insurers can offer tailored solutions that meet each customer’s requirements.

As digitalization continues to revolutionize the insurance industry, it’s clear that it will be a crucial driver of success for companies in Canada and around the world in the years ahead.

Benefits of Online Quotes and Virtual Agents

Online quotes and virtual agents are the most popular digital solutions insurance providers utilize today. Online quotes allow customers to compare rates from different insurers in minutes without ever leaving their homes. It will enable them to make an informed decision and choose the coverage that best fits their needs.

Virtual agents provide customers with additional convenience, allowing them to access information about policies and coverage options directly through an AI-driven chatbot or automated system. These tools make it easier for customers to understand complex insurance details, ask questions, and find the right policy at the right price.

In addition, online quotes and virtual agents can be used for more than just shopping around—they can also help insurers reduce costs associated with customer acquisition and customer service.

Mobile-Friendly Services for Customers

As more customers rely on their mobile devices for day-to-day tasks, insurers must provide mobile services optimized for various platforms. Mobile apps allow customers to access insurance information from any device, anytime and anywhere. It enables them to check policy details, file claims, or review coverage options without visiting an office or waiting with customer service representatives on hold.

Insurers also use other mobile technologies, such as telematics and location-tracking devices. Telematics tracks drivers’ real-time behaviours to offer more accurate rates and discounts based on individual habits. Location tracking devices can help insurers assess risks associated with specific areas—which is especially important regarding natural disasters or other environmental risks.

Challenges Faced by Insurers in the Digital Era

Digital transformation is a complex process, and insurers must address particular challenges. Security remains one of the top customer concerns—and with good reason, as cybercrime is increasing alarmingly. Insurers must secure their platforms to protect sensitive customer data from malicious actors.

In addition, insurers have had difficulty keeping up with technological advancements—especially when developing innovative products and services. It can be incredibly challenging for smaller companies with limited resources and budgets. Companies must invest in research and development to stay ahead of the curve.

Finally, digital transformation requires significant investments in time, money, and resources that can sometimes lead to inefficient processes or failed projects if not managed correctly. Insurers must develop strategies and procedures tailored to their needs to ensure successful digital transformation.

What to Look For When Choosing an Online Insurance Provider

When choosing an online insurance provider, several important factors must be considered.

First, ensuring the insurer has a solid reputation and track record of providing quality services is essential. It’s also crucial to ensure that the provider offers competitive rates and coverage for the specific type of insurance you need.

It’s also important to research the customer service options available with your potential insurer. Look for customer reviews and complaints and contact details such as telephone numbers or email addresses should you need to contact them in the future. Consider whether they offer additional services such as discounts, rewards, or policy management tools that could be helpful.

Finally, check if the insurer provides various payment options, such as online payment systems like PayPal and credit cards. These can often be convenient methods of paying premiums and can help you keep track of payments more efficiently.

Some insurers may also offer flexible payment options that allow you to spread your payments out over time rather than having to pay one lump sum payment.
